CVE-2020-1187
vulnerability analysis and mitigation

Overview

An elevation of privilege vulnerability exists in the Windows State Repository Service when it improperly handles objects in memory, identified as CVE-2020-1187. This vulnerability affects multiple versions of Microsoft Windows 10 and Windows Server 2016 (NVD, MITRE).

Technical details

The vulnerability has been assigned a CVSS v3.1 base score of 7.8 (HIGH) with the vector string CVSS:3.1/AV:L/AC:L/PR:L/UI:N/S:U/C:H/I:H/A:H. This indicates that the vulnerability requires local access, low attack complexity, low privileges, and no user interaction, while potentially impacting confidentiality, integrity, and availability at high levels (NVD).

Impact

If successfully exploited, this vulnerability could allow an attacker to gain elevated privileges on affected systems, potentially leading to complete system compromise with high impacts on confidentiality, integrity, and availability (NVD).

Exploitability

The vulnerability requires local access and low privileges for exploitation. The attack complexity is considered low, suggesting that the vulnerability is relatively straightforward to exploit once an attacker has the necessary local access (NVD).

Mitigation and workarounds

Microsoft has released security updates to address this vulnerability. Users should apply the appropriate patches through Windows Update to protect their systems (MITRE).
